Transaction 34cbe93382006f9be437ff382828f0e608502381a6459e2ad34176bfa9507a99
2 Input
2 Outputs
- 34cbe93382006f9be437ff382828f0e608502381a6459e2ad34176bfa9507a99:0
- 34cbe93382006f9be437ff382828f0e608502381a6459e2ad34176bfa9507a99:1
value 25937916
address 16f2EUFHgrPmhuSFfyUGLxWSr2WMcC32Ra
value 246000000
address 18UWYmamQuP5AtqwAxnNLYqUkL79aW3GCL